Transaction d56202fdc362b4a7ca408b3e3839bacc1e660bd1249bbed6be030feff2ef6e18
2 Input
2 Outputs
- d56202fdc362b4a7ca408b3e3839bacc1e660bd1249bbed6be030feff2ef6e18:0
- d56202fdc362b4a7ca408b3e3839bacc1e660bd1249bbed6be030feff2ef6e18:1
value 2108741
address 1EKwCurPGLkyXCWYc1zGjpguPt1fFyUreP
value 4364916
address 16FPjDrJ9ndjZR8BXzyhetM7o312ncmk5i